Danny! is a former student of the Savannah College of Art & Design. He often wears an oxford shirt and pinstriped necktie, and has gained notoriety for prank-calling celebrities. In 2012 Danny! rose to prominence shortly following the proclamation by The Roots drummer Questlove that there was strong interest from Jay-Z; he was subsequently signed as the flagship artist to Questlove's re-launched Okayplayer Records after years of being loosely affiliated with the company. In support of the new venture Danny! made his television debut on "Late Night With Jimmy Fallon" in September 2012, premiering his song "Evil" alongside The Roots.
Prior to this Danny! was most notable for his efficacious DIY approach to his music career, producing virtually every aspect of his albums—from the production to the cover art and even promotion—by himself to varying degrees of acclaim. He would field praise for his self-released concept records "Charm" and "And I Love H.E.R.", the latter named by ABC News as one of the best 50 albums of 2008, before releasing the "anti-album" "Where Is Danny?" in early 2011. After signing to Okayplayer Records the following year, Danny! completed his trilogy of conceptual albums with "Payback".

In Danny!'s song "Evil," featuring Gavin Castleton and Amber Tamblyn, the lyrics tell the story of a man who struggles with past mistakes and the consequences that may come as a result. The hook is sung by Gavin Castleton who claims that he feels a sickness underneath his skin, and that he will be allowed into heaven by God despite any evil he may have done on Earth. In the first verse, Danny! raps about feeling lost and surrounded by "circus clowns" who throw pies his way. He admits to being lost and not knowing where his sanity is. In the second verse, Danny! admits to being paranoid and feeling as though he will be killed for the mistakes he has made. He claims he is one step away from being consumed by evil and engraved in a tomb of ruined reputation. The bridge repeats the lines, "Only God can judge me," as a way to say that he cannot be judged by anyone else. The outro sung by Amber Tamblyn is a story of regret as she confesses to not being the daughter she should have been and knowing someone who died because they couldn't keep their hands off her.
Overall, the song describes a struggle with morality, regret, and paranoia. The singer feels lost and as though he is on the brink of being consumed by evil, but still feels as though he is a human being that deserves forgiveness. The presence of God and the idea that only God can judge someone adds a spiritual element to the lyrics.
